Information for the question:
Assume that you manage a risky portfolio with an expected rate of return of 17% and a standard deviation of 27%. The T-bill rate is 7%.
Your client chooses to invest 70% of a portfolio in your fund and 30% in a T-bill money market fund.
Risky portfolio includes:
Stock A |
27% |
|
Stock B |
33% |
|
Stock C |
40% |

Transcribed Image Text:Use the information in problem 12, and assume your client's utility function is U = E(r) – Ao?.
1. What is his optimal allocation y, if his risk aversion, A, is 2, 5, or 10?
2. What if the expected return on your fund goes up to 20% (for A = 2)?
3. What if the return standard deviation of your fund goes up to 35% (for A = 2; expected
return is still 17%)?
